‘Héroines’ is a tribute to three French heroines. The composers Paule Maurice (1910-1967), Jeanine Rueff (1922-1999) and Lucie Robert (1936-2019) have all been described as exceptionally talented. However, none have won wide acclaim among the general public.

This is just one of the many similarities between the three women. All three attended the Conservatoire National Supérieur de Musique (CNSM) in Paris. After graduation they became professors themselves at the CNSM. Paule Maurice taught sight reading, Jeanine Rueff taught ear training and harmony and Lucie Robert taught harmony, music theory and piano.

Saxophonist Annelies Vrieswijk has played with a number of ensembles, including with the Rodion Trio and the Syrène Saxophone Quartet where their recordings have been critically acclaimed.

As a freelance musician she has played with many outstanding Dutch ensembles and orchestras, including the Royal Concertgebouw Orchestra, the Radio Filharmonisch Orkest, the Netherlands Philharmonic Orchestra and the North Netherlands Symphony Orchestra.
